Executive Summary

PUBLIC Verdi is building a retrofit automation platform for agricultural irrigation, a bet that addresses the immediate, capital-constrained reality of modern farming with a hardware-plus-software wedge into broader climate adaptation. Founded in 2019 and based in Vancouver, the company has installed over 5,000 devices across North America, automating irrigation for more than 5,000 acres by retrofitting intelligence onto existing farm infrastructure in a claimed single day [verdi.ag, retrieved 2024] [techcouver.com, May 2025]. Its core differentiation lies in this retrofit approach, which avoids the prohibitive cost and disruption of full system replacements, and is backed by a recently approved US patent for its irrigation automation technology [facebook.com/verdiagriculture] [newaginternational.com, May 2025].

The founding team, led by CEO Arthur Chen, has guided the company through a seed-stage financing journey totaling approximately $9.5 million, with a $4.7 million round closed in May 2025 [CB Insights, May 2025] [vantechjournal.com]. The business model combines the sale of proprietary hardware,block controllers, smart valves, and row-level controllers,with a software platform for remote control, scheduling, and data-driven insights, targeting high-value permanent crops like nuts, vineyards, and orchards [verdi.ag, retrieved 2024]. Public traction claims are significant, citing up to 70% water savings, 90% labor savings, and 20% yield improvements for users, though these are generalized performance metrics rather than named, audited case studies [techcouver.com, May 2025].

Over the next 12-18 months, the key watch points will be the scalability of its sales and installation operations beyond the initial 5,000-device footprint, the conversion of its reported water and labor savings into hard renewal and expansion revenue from enterprise food brands, and any technological expansion from its irrigation wedge into the broader "plant healthcare" platform it envisions.

Company Overview

PUBLIC Verdi operates as a Vancouver-based climate-tech startup, founded in 2019 with the stated aim of making precision irrigation automation accessible to farms and large food brands [verdi.ag, retrieved 2024]. The company's public narrative centers on retrofitting intelligence onto existing agricultural infrastructure, a practical approach intended to lower adoption barriers in a traditionally conservative sector.

The founding team includes Arthur Chen, identified as CEO, alongside Roman Kozak as CTO and Jacky Jiang as a technical co-founder [Wine Business Analytics] [Craft.co, retrieved 2026]. Public milestones are anchored by hardware deployment and funding. The company reports having over 5,000 devices installed, automating irrigation for more than 5,000 acres of farmland in North America [verdi.ag, retrieved 2024] [techcouver.com, May 2025]. Capitalization has progressed through several seed rounds, with a total of approximately $9.5 million disclosed across multiple closes, the most recent being a $4.7 million seed round noted in May 2025 [CB Insights, May 2025] [vantechjournal.com, retrieved 2026]. The company has also participated in accelerator programs, including Alchemist Accelerator and HATCH [CB Insights, May 2023].

Product and Technology

MIXED Verdi's core proposition is a retrofit hardware and software system designed to bring precision irrigation to existing farm infrastructure. The company's patented smart devices attach to current valves and pumps, enabling wireless automation and remote control without requiring a full system replacement, a process the company claims can be completed in one day [verdi.ag, retrieved 2024]. This hardware layer is managed through a mobile application that provides real-time verification, scheduling, and instant alerts for leaks or other system anomalies [verdi.ag, retrieved 2024]. The combined system aims to deliver immediate operational benefits, with company claims of up to 90% labor savings and up to 70% water savings for users [techcouver.com, May 2025].

The software platform adds a data science layer on top of this automation. It is described as a tool for generating hyper-specific farm actions, starting with irrigation optimization [Perplexity Sonar Pro Brief, retrieved 2024]. The platform supports advanced capabilities like row-level irrigation control and remote leak detection, moving beyond simple scheduling to more nuanced, condition-based water application [ThriveAgriFood, May 2025]. While the company's marketing references AI-powered software for efficiency [igrownews.com, May 2025], the specific algorithms, data inputs, and model architecture are not detailed in public materials. The product suite is targeted at high-value permanent crops, with explicit support for nuts, vineyards, orchards, and berries [verdi.ag, retrieved 2024].

  • Deployment and support. The company emphasizes a full-service model, offering installation training, 24/7 remote system monitoring, and a 90-day satisfaction guarantee [verdi.ag, retrieved 2024]. This bundled approach is likely aimed at reducing adoption friction for farm operators who may lack in-house technical expertise.
  • Technical validation. A key piece of external validation is the approval of a patent for irrigation automation by the US Patent Office, as announced by the company [facebook.com/verdiagriculture]. This provides a degree of defensibility for the core hardware and control methodology.

Market Research

PUBLIC

Precision irrigation is moving from a niche efficiency tool to a core operational necessity, driven by a tightening vise of water scarcity, rising input costs, and intensifying climate volatility. While Verdi does not publish its own market sizing, the demand drivers it targets are well-documented in broader agricultural technology and water management reports.

The total addressable market for smart irrigation solutions is substantial, though estimates vary by scope. A 2023 report from Grand View Research valued the global smart irrigation market at $1.7 billion, projecting a compound annual growth rate of 14.5% through 2030 [Grand View Research, 2023]. A more focused analysis by MarketsandMarkets on the precision agriculture market, which includes irrigation as a key component, estimated its value at $7.0 billion in 2021, growing to $12.8 billion by 2026 [MarketsandMarkets, 2021]. For North America, a primary target for Verdi, the irrigation automation market was valued at approximately $2.4 billion in 2022, with expectations for steady growth as adoption accelerates beyond early adopters [Mordor Intelligence, 2022].

Several concurrent macro forces are converging to accelerate adoption. Chronic drought conditions across key agricultural regions in the western United States and Canada have led to increased water regulation and allocation pressures, making conservation a financial imperative. Labor availability remains a persistent challenge, with the agricultural sector reporting consistent shortages and rising wage costs [USDA, 2023]. Furthermore, large food brands and retailers are increasingly implementing sustainability sourcing requirements, creating a pull-through demand for suppliers to document and improve water use efficiency.

Verdi's retrofit approach positions it within the serviceable obtainable market for upgrading existing irrigation infrastructure, a segment that avoids the high capital cost and disruption of full system replacement. Adjacent and substitute markets include traditional irrigation equipment from major incumbents, broader farm management software platforms that may add irrigation modules, and soil moisture sensor networks. Regulatory forces, such as the Sustainable Groundwater Management Act (SGMA) in California, are creating a compliance-driven market for water accounting and verification tools that goes beyond voluntary efficiency [California Department of Water Resources].

Competitive Landscape

MIXED

Verdi enters a competitive field defined by long-established irrigation giants and a newer wave of software-centric agtech platforms, positioning itself as a retrofit automation specialist for high-value specialty crops.

Competition unfolds across distinct, overlapping segments. The incumbent hardware manufacturers,Jain, Netafim, and Toro,dominate the market for new irrigation system installations. Their advantage lies in decades of brand trust, global supply chains, and relationships with large-scale farm operations. A second segment comprises pure-play software and sensor platforms, like CropX or Arable, which offer monitoring and analytics but often lack direct, physical control over valves and pumps. Verdi's wedge sits between these groups, combining proprietary hardware for control with a software layer for optimization, but specifically targeting the retrofit market. This addresses a critical pain point for growers with sunk capital in existing irrigation infrastructure who are unwilling or unable to undertake a full system replacement.

Verdi's current defensible edge appears to be its patented retrofit technology and its focused application on high-value permanent crops. The claim that its system can be installed in one day on existing infrastructure directly counters a major adoption barrier posed by the incumbents' new-system model [verdi.ag, retrieved 2024]. Furthermore, capabilities like row-level irrigation control and remote leak detection are tailored for orchards, vineyards, and nut groves, where water precision directly impacts yield and quality. This focus builds early expertise and customer references in a lucrative niche. However, this edge is perishable. It relies on continued technical execution to maintain reliability advantages and on sales execution to build a dense installed base before incumbents develop or acquire similar retrofit solutions. The company's software and data science layer, while a stated part of the platform, is less differentiated in a market filling with AI-driven agronomic recommendations.

The company's most significant exposure is to the distribution and scale of the established players. Netafim and Toro have entrenched relationships with agricultural distributors and dealers, a channel Verdi has yet to demonstrate it can penetrate at scale. While Verdi has announced a partnership with a regional distributor like Vanden Bussche Irrigation [verdi.ag/blog/verdi-partners-with-vanden-bussche-irrigation, retrieved 2026], building a comparable network nationally or globally requires substantial time and capital. Furthermore, the incumbents' extensive service and support organizations present a high barrier for a startup with a team estimated at between 23 and 60 employees [Crunchbase, retrieved 2024]; [LinkedIn, retrieved 2024]; [builtinvancouver.org, retrieved 2026]. Verdi also does not currently compete in the broad-acre row-crop segment (e.g., corn, soybeans), where scale is measured in tens of thousands of acres and purchasing decisions are heavily influenced by commodity prices.

The most plausible 18-month scenario involves continued niche consolidation. Verdi is likely to win if it can convert its early traction in North American specialty crops,over 5,000 acres and 5,000+ devices installed [techcouver.com, May 2025]; [verdi.ag, retrieved 2024],into a repeatable, channel-driven sales motion that locks in regional distributors. A loser in this period could be smaller, undifferentiated sensor-only platforms that fail to demonstrate tangible operational savings beyond data visualization. The strategic risk for Verdi is that a major incumbent, recognizing the retrofit opportunity, launches a competitive product line, leveraging its existing customer relationships to slow Verdi's growth. The outcome will hinge less on technological novelty and more on the speed of commercial execution and partnership development.

Opportunity

PUBLIC Verdi’s opportunity is defined by the potential to become the default operating system for water and crop management on high-value farmland, translating incremental hardware sales into a recurring data and service platform with enterprise-scale economics.

The headline opportunity rests on establishing Verdi as the category-defining platform for climate-resilient agriculture, starting with irrigation. The company’s wedge is not a novel sensor but a retrofit automation layer that works with existing, aging farm infrastructure, a choice that directly addresses the primary adoption barrier in a conservative industry [verdi.ag, retrieved 2024]. This positions Verdi to capture the operational data layer for thousands of farms, moving beyond one-time hardware sales toward a platform that orchestrates water, nutrients, and labor based on plant-level data. The evidence that this outcome is reachable, not merely aspirational, comes from the company’s reported traction: over 5,000 devices installed automating irrigation for more than 5,000 acres in North America, with claimed efficiency gains of up to 90% labor savings and 70% water savings for users [techcouver.com, May 2025]. These metrics suggest the core value proposition is resonating at a commercial scale, providing a foundation to expand into adjacent farm management actions.

Compounding for Verdi looks like a data flywheel reinforced by physical deployment. Each installed controller generates granular data on soil moisture, valve performance, and crop response. This dataset, aggregated across thousands of acres and crop types, improves the predictive accuracy of the company’s AI models for irrigation scheduling and anomaly detection (like leaks) [igrownews.com, May 2025]. Better models lead to more demonstrable customer savings,the company estimates it saved users over 100 million liters of water in 2024 [ThriveAgriFood, May 2025],which in turn drives further adoption and more data. This loop creates a product that becomes more valuable with each new farm connected, potentially locking in customers through operational dependency and continuous optimization insights.
